Warm Caps
These reversible warm caps were specially designed for charity gifting to certain people in Nepal. They are two layers thick, and have a gathered shaping to add even more warmth.
The caps are reversible, with one side worked in K1P1 ribbing. The other side is knitted in stockinette. The ribbing allows for fit on a wide variety of head sizes, from child up to adult.
Any combination of yarn that knits at a bulky weight works for these caps. For some I’ve used a worsted weight held together with two or three lace weight yarns. Others I’ve used two worsted weights held together.
You can try it on as you work to judge how long to make it!
Allow your creativity to run wild…use up your scrap yarn…
These caps are super-easy and quick to make.
